Neither will demould in 30 mins for miniatures. You're probably looking around 40mins, to be honest. My recommendation is 305 in summer, 300 in winter. The ABL Stevens stuff is decent, but Smooth-On blows it out of the water as far a post-cure working properties go. Almost like a hard injection plastic where the ABLS stuff is more brittle.
I buy the big container from Smooth-On and decant it into 2x6 wide-mouth HDPE bottles I bought on eBay. This minimises the exposure to air. Even the 'working' bottles keep well as the surface exposed to air is small compared with the container in which it is supplied. The ABLS stuff seems to have a shorter open shelf life.
Smooth-On charge a premium anyway, but their trial packs are EXPENSIVE! At the larger size, the price becomes more reasonable, and certainly reflects the difference in quality.
Trial price/kg inc. delivery:
ABLS: £17.03 (2 kg)
S-O: £35.58 (.86 kg)
Decent size price/kg inc. delivery:
ABLS: £11.33 (10 kg)
S-O: £17.30 (7 kg)
